Output e4cb3e00f3cddf5223c9eb07b98178dcb68a91fe594a97cec39bf64cc170b62d:0

value
577550374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baec38fe3ff23afd0c1175b2dd57fca5d34f4b OP_EQUAL
address
3BWe9gx3vXZsWGxno6C1q3hYMM97dvcmSB
transaction
e4cb3e00f3cddf5223c9eb07b98178dcb68a91fe594a97cec39bf64cc170b62d
spent
true